Explore the intricate relationship between large-scale ocean circulation and climate in this comprehensive lecture on deep convection and overturning. Delve into the complex dynamics of ocean currents and their impact on global climate systems. Gain insights into the processes of deep water formation and the overturning circulation that plays a crucial role in heat and nutrient distribution across the world's oceans. Examine the mechanisms driving these phenomena and their implications for long-term climate patterns. Learn about cutting-edge research and models used to study these large-scale oceanic processes. This lecture, part of a pedagogical program on mathematical modeling of climate, ocean, and atmosphere processes, is designed for students with varying levels of background knowledge, making it accessible to both undergraduate and graduate-level audiences interested in oceanography and climate science.
